Understanding Assault Laws in Fort Worth
Understanding Fort Worth Assault Laws is crucial for anyone navigating this complex legal landscape. In Fort Worth, assault is categorized into two main types: simple assault and aggravated assault (discover more), each carrying distinct penalties and legal implications. Simple assault, defined as an intentional threat or act that places another in fear of imminent bodily harm, is a Class A misdemeanor, punishable by up to a year in jail and a fine. Aggravated assault, on the other hand, involves the use or threat of a deadly weapon or serious bodily injury, classified as a felony that can result in imprisonment for five to 99 years.

Your rights during an assault investigation are fundamental to ensuring a fair process. The Fifth Amendment protects you from self-incrimination, allowing you to remain silent and consult with an attorney.
